DESIGN OF QUEUING SYSTEM USING PRIORITY QUEUE ALGORITHM AND MULTI CHANNEL MULTI PHASE METHOD AT WEBSITE-BASED PATIENT REGISTRATION SECTION (CASE STUDY OF DONGGALA HEALTH CENTER) Anita, Ayu; Ardiansyah, Rizka; Lapatta, Nouval Trezandy; Angreni, Dwi Shinta; Laila, Rahmah

Abstract

This research was conducted to regulate the queuing process which is often longer than the service standards set in the Decree of the Minister of Health Number 129 / Menkes / SK / II / 2008 stipulates that the waiting time for outpatients is equal to 60 minutes or less than 60 minutes, This study aims to design and build a website-based electronic queuing system at Puskesmas Donggala using the Priority Queue algorithm and the Multi Channel Multi Phase method. This system is designed to improve the efficiency of patient registration by reducing waiting time and providing priority for patients with emergency conditions. The research method includes data collection through observation and interviews, as well as system testing through simulation. The results show that the proposed system can reduce waiting time and increase patient satisfaction. The implementation of this system is expected to provide an effective solution to queuing problems in health facilities.
Geographical Information System Shortes Path Delivery Of Goods Using The Bellman-Ford And Dijkstra Algorithm (Case Study J&T Palu City) Septiani, Rini; Joefrie, Yuri Yudhaswana; Ardiansyah, Rizka; Pratama, Septiano Anggun; Laila, Rahmah

Abstract

The demand for goods delivery services (expedition services) is currently growing very rapidly to support the many e-commerce companies that have sprung up in Indonesia. In the delivery process, there is often a delay in delivery due to the random delivery path of the delivery service courier. The development of information technology, especially computer technology, can be used to solve problems in various fields of work. This study aims to optimize the determination of Goods Delivery routes using the Bellman-Ford and Dijkstra Algorithms. The case study was conducted at JT Goods Delivery Services in Palu City, Central Sulawesi. The data used in this study is the distance data between the delivery location points of goods taken from Google Maps. This research was conducted by collecting data on the distance between the source point and the location of the delivery of goods. By using the Bellman-Ford and Dijkstra Algorithms, the Bellman-Ford Algorithm is used to handle graphs with negative weights and detect negative cycles, while the Dijkstra Algorithm is more efficient on graphs with positive weights, focusing on finding the shortest path from one point to all other points, the distance and time required for shipping goods can be minimized so that the efficiency of shipping goods can be increased

Artikel Analisis Sentimen terhadap Resolusi Genjatan Senjata PBB 2023: Studi pada 10 Negara Penolak Resolusi Konflik Israel-Palestina Qofifa, Sitti Nurlaili; Ardiansyah, Rizka; Joefrie, Yuri Yudhaswana; Wirdayanti; Lapatta, Nouval Trezandy

Abstract

The Israeli-Palestinian conflict is the longest conflict that still has not found a bright spot. In December 2023 the UN again gave the latest resolution with the title “Armistice” this resolution received pros and cons from UN member states. The number of pro countries is 150 countries, contra as many as 10 countries and 23 countries abstain. This study aims to investigate whether the 10 countries that voted against the UN resolution represent the interests of their people or only represent the interests of their country. This research approach uses sentiment analysis on platform X with the Support Vector Machine method. Data was taken from March 2024 to the latest data, 137,447 data were obtained with 5 countries using non-English languages and 4 countries using English. Each data from these countries was successfully classified into positive and negative classes. The survey was conducted on 9 countries with an average positive sentiment of 34.82% and an average negative sentiment of 77.41%. The results of this research show that the decisions made by the 10 countries that rejected the resolution represent the voice of their people.

Comparative Performance Analysis of GRPC and Rest API Under Various Traffic Conditions and Data Sizes Using a Quantitative Approach Ain, Moch. Zukhruf; Rizka Ardiansyah; Septiano Anggun Pratama; Muhammad Akbar; Nouval Trezandy Lapatta

Abstract

Web 3.0 presents challenges in efficient data exchange, especially in decentralized systems. REST API (HTTP/1.1) remains widely used due to its broad compatibility but has communication inefficiencies, while gRPC (HTTP/2) offers better performance with multiplexing and Protocol Buffers. This study compares REST API and gRPC under various traffic conditions and data sizes using Apache JMeter and Wireshark, measuring throughput, response time, latency, and data transfer efficiency. Results show that REST API has higher throughput in low-traffic scenarios (995 vs. 29.5 req/min) and faster GET response time (3 ms vs. 20 ms), while gRPC excels in large data transfers (276.34 KB/s vs. 134.1 KB/s) and stable latency (0.147 ms). However, ANOVA analysis (p > 0.05) indicates no statistically significant difference. REST API is ideal for standard web applications, while gRPC is suited for microservices and real-time systems.

PERBANDINGAN AKURASI LINEAR REGRESSION DAN SUPPORT VECTOR REGRESSION DALAM PREDIKSI SUHU RATA-RATA Lesnusa, Gideon Namlea; Dwi Shinta Angreni; Ardiansyah, Rizka

Abstract

The weather in Indonesia varies significantly and is influenced by geographical location, topography, and regional climate. Weather patterns differ between the western and eastern parts of Indonesia. This study explores time series models to predict weather data in Palu City, a region that is complex due to various weather factors. The focus is on the unique weather patterns reflected by the geography and topography of Palu City. Evaluation was conducted on time series models, including Linear Regression and Support Vector Regression (SVR), to estimate weather conditions in Palu City. The evaluation results show that the SVR model has an RMSE of 0.6302, while linear regression has an RMSE of 0.6328. This research has the potential to improve early warning and decision-making regarding extreme weather
The Implementation and Analysis of The Proof of Work Consensus in Blockchain Therry, Alvin Christian Davidson; Ardiansyah, Rizka; Pusadan, Mohammad Yazdi; Joefrie, Yuri Yudhaswana; Kasim, Anita Ahmad

Abstract

Communication in peer-to-peer (P2P) networks presents challenges in maintaining security, data integrity, and decentralization. Consensus mechanisms play a crucial role in addressing these challenges by validating data and ensuring that each entity has synchronized data without intermediaries. This research focuses on the implementation and analysis of the Proof of Work (PoW) consensus mechanism, widely used in blockchain, to enhance understanding of its functions, benefits, and workings or flow. This research, conducted using the Go programming language, successfully implements Proof of Work (PoW) as a security measure, ensuring data integrity, and preventing manipulation. Through black-box testing, this research confirms the functionality and reliability of the implemented Proof of Work (PoW) consensus. These findings contribute to a deeper understanding of consensus mechanisms, offering insights to optimize blockchain protocols and foster trust among entities. This research highlights the relevance of sustainable Proof of Work (PoW) in blockchain technology, emphasizing its role in enhancing security and ensuring data integrity in decentralized networks.
